In an age where former public figures often reinvent themselves as influencers, Michelle Obama’s latest ventures shine a spotlight on a trend of personal and cultural reflection. As a former first lady, Michelle Obama is not just riding the wave of nostalgia but reshaping how past leaders interact with the public. Her appearances on major fashion magazine covers signal more than personal branding; they reflect a bid to influence cultural conversations. But with all the adoration, one must ask whether the media frenzy truly matches the substance behind her endeavors.

Michelle Obama’s new podcast promises to take listeners on a journey of introspection with tales from her White House years. She spells out that, while seemingly privileged, her time there was not without personal costs. Strikingly, she speaks about being personally affected by those high-profile years, conveying the emotional toll of public service. While any role at that level comes with sacrifices, her remarks about buying groceries and paying for flights might strike some as tone-deaf, given the everyday realities faced by most Americans.

A primary theme in Michelle Obama’s message is about personal recovery and empowerment; unsurprisingly, topics of racial injustice emerge prominently. However, weaving these themes with statements about the country’s faults may sound more like a sweeping critique than a constructive conversation starter. This approach could encourage dialogue on ongoing issues, yet it risks alienating those who feel the emphasis should be on solutions instead of airing grievances.

In her reflections on marriage and parenting, Michelle Obama adopts a bold, if not controversial, stance. Her commentary pivoted around the hardships accompanying traditional family roles and expectations, casting marriage in a rather somber light. By suggesting that familial struggles are inevitable, she invites debate on gender roles and equality within households. However, her descriptions verge on disparaging, potentially alienating those who view family life differently.

In the end, Michelle Obama’s ventures demand attention, not merely for their content but for the broader cultural influence they exert. As she steps into the spotlight with her podcast and book, her narrative challenges traditional perceptions about former first ladies’ roles. Whether these reflections serve as an uplifting guide or as divisive declarations will be revealed as audiences decide whether Michelle Obama’s journey resonates with their reality.
